A new Telford MP has been elected after Labour's Shaun Davies emerged victorious in the early hours of Friday.
The 38-year-old leader of Telford & Wrekin Council beat the other four candidates to replace Lucy Allan, who represented the town for the Conservatives from 2015 until earlier this year.
Mr Davies, who secured 18,212 votes, won by over 7,000 votes to the Reform candidate who came second with 11,110 votes. The Conservative candidate, Hannah Campbell came third with 8,728 votes. “I will be all of your voices in Telford. I will be all of your voices in Parliament working nationally to deliver more locally.
“This changed Labour party of today is focussed on the things that matter most to working people and pensioners here in Telford: economic security, lower bills, safer streets, the NHS back on its feet, securing our borders and opportunities for our young people and children, so if this boy from Dawley can become member of parliament for Telford then the sky is the limit for every Telford young person here.
